A high quality studio boom arm is more than a simple mic holder; it acts as the foundation of your recording workflow. The best options balance weight capacity, range of motion, and ease of adjustment. Look for arms that can support a wide variety of microphones, from dynamic podcast mics to studio-grade condensers, without dragging or drifting. Materials matter: steel or aircraft-grade aluminum provide sturdiness, while a well designed joint system prevents abrupt clanks or pressure on the mic thread. Consider also the overall footprint of the arm; a compact base with a long reach can keep your desk free for notes, screens, and mixing equipment.
Smooth motion depends on both construction quality and the type of joints used. Gas springs or counterweight systems give you fluid vertical and horizontal moves, but only if the dampers are calibrated correctly. Pay attention to the tilt and swivel range; a good arm allows micro adjustments so you can angle the mic toward your mouth without forcing a loud repositioning. Clamps should be robust, with secure mounting to a desk or wall. Most professionals favor a desk clamp or grommet mount that stays firm under regular use. Also verify compatibility with your desk thickness and panel material to avoid slipping or damage over time.
Proper hardware features determine long-term stability and easing of setup.
Choosing a professional studio boom arm begins with assessing microphone compatibility and weight ratings. Start by listing your typical mic models and their combined weight, then compare this to the arm’s stated load capacity. Exceeding the limit can lead to sagging, drift, or abrupt movement. Don’t overlook the cable management system; integrated channels or clips help keep cables tidy and reduce noise from tugging. Consider how often you will reposition the mic and whether you need fine tuning for on mic screen or pop filter rig. A thoughtful design will minimize swivels that could loosen over time and degrade performance.

In addition to load capacity, examine the clamp design and vertical reach. A dependable clamp should resist creeping under heavy use, while a strong yoke or collar keeps the mic in place after adjustments. Check for adjustable tension on the arm’s joints, allowing you to set resistance so the arm remains in position without continuous tightening. The smoother the movement, the more comfortable it is to work with during long sessions. Look for reinforced joints where the arm bends; these zones often wear first if the arm is repeatedly moved to extremes.
Practical testing and setup can reveal how it behaves under real conditions.
A sound choice integrates anti corrosion finishes and high quality bearings. Exterior coatings should withstand frequent handling and desk vibrations without peeling or dulling. Interior components, like bushings and bearings, should be rated for continuous motion with minimal play. If you anticipate collaborations or multi-studio use, a quick release or modular accessory mounting can save time. Accessories such as two mic clips, a tablet holder, or a small light mount become vastly more convenient when the arm’s geometry supports additional components without crowding the desk. Always confirm compatibility with any extra gear before buying.

Consider the noise profile of the arm during operation. Some rigid systems transmit subtle mechanical sounds into the mic path, especially when weight shifts or when the arm is moved quickly. Look for damped or rubber-coated contact points and silent, grease-lubricated joints. Again, check the seating of the clamp and base; a loose fit can introduce rattling as you adjust height or angle. Finally, assess warranty coverage; robust arms often come with multi year guarantees, a sign the manufacturer expects heavy usage and stands behind performance.
Real world use reveals whether a boom arm fits your workflow.
Before finalizing a purchase, simulate a typical session to test performance. Check how your ignition of cues, countdowns, and vocal patterns feel as you lean into the mic. Move from a resting position to a dynamic stance and observe any micro shifts or resistance that might interrupt your workflow. A well tuned arm should offer predictable, repeatable motion and maintain the mic’s position once set. If you work in tight spaces, verify that the arm can clear any monitors, keyboards, or lighting rigs without collision. A compact footprint with high stability is often a smarter choice than a longer arm that swamps the desk.
Insurance against damage is another factor; opt for a design that reduces tipping risk on unstable surfaces. A heavy base or anchored wall mount can dramatically improve steadiness during aggressive mic moves. Evaluate the arm’s overall height range; the ability to lower the mic to mouth level for intimate reads and then raise for room ambience is valuable. Also consider color and finish, which matter in a studio with aesthetics and client expectations. A visually cohesive installation helps you maintain a professional impression during recordings and remote calls alike.

Final considerations for a durable, high performance purchase.
Ergonomics play a crucial role in choosing a studio arm; it should minimize shoulder strain during long sessions. A smooth glide helps you find a natural posture, especially when recording multiple takes back to back. The best arms offer lockable positions at common angles, so you don’t have to chase the mic between takes. In addition, integrated cable channels prevent snagging and snag free rewinding. Durable finishes keep the arm looking professional in studio photos, while reinforced joints defend against frequent reuse. If you collaborate with others, modular design supports quick configuration changes without disrupting the entire setup.
Remember that installation quality is as important as the arm’s engineering. A secure desk clamp may require an extra gasket or padding to protect sensitive surfaces. When mounting to a wall, ensure studs are properly located and the bracket is rated for dynamic loads. After installation, test repeated movements across your full range to verify stability. Periodic maintenance—tightening screws, cleaning joints, applying fresh lubricant—extends the life of the arm and preserves its smoothness. A disciplined maintenance routine pays off in consistent performance and fewer interruptions during shows or recordings.
Price often reflects build quality, but not every premium arm is the right fit for your studio. Evaluate the value by weighing material quality, load capacity, motion smoothness, and clamp reliability against your budget. A feature heavy model may offer convenience but could be slower to adjust precisely in practice. Check user reviews for recurrent issues such as looseness, corrosion, or clamp slipping. A good buy balances robust hardware with practical usability: easy adjustments, quiet operation, and reliable support when you need replacements or parts. Investing in a trusted brand can reduce disappointing surprises during critical production moments.
In conclusion, selecting the ideal boom arm combines practical testing with thoughtful consideration of your space and microphone needs. Start by confirming weight support and clamp compatibility, then verify motion smoothness and locking reliability through deliberate adjustments. Consider the arm’s footprint and cable management to keep your workspace clean and efficient. Finally, align your choice with a policy of maintenance and after sales support, ensuring you can service or upgrade components as your studio evolves. A well chosen, robust boom arm becomes an invisible ally, letting you focus on voice, timing, and creative storytelling without equipment friction.
